United Airlines hand luggage & liquid rules
United Basic Economy on most US routes includes only a personal item — no full-size carry-on. Standard Economy and above include a carry-on (56×35×22 cm, 22×14×9 in) plus a personal item. Liquids follow TSA's 3-1-1 rule (3.4 oz per container, one quart bag).
Cabin bag allowance
Personal item43 × 25 × 22 cm
9×10×17 in. Free on every fare.
Overhead cabin bag56 × 35 × 22 cm · paid
22×14×9 in. Not included in domestic Basic Economy.
Liquid rules on this airline
- TSA 3-1-1 applies: 3.4 oz (100 ml) per container, one quart-size clear bag.
- United does not add its own liquid restriction on top.
Duty-free & connections
- International duty-free liquids in the sealed STEB with receipt are allowed on connecting United flights.
Medicines, baby milk, batteries & vapes
- Baby formula, breast milk and juice for infants are TSA-exempt.
- Medications in liquid form are TSA-exempt when declared.
- Vape devices and spare lithium batteries: cabin only.

Do I get a carry-on in United Basic Economy?
On most US domestic routes, no — only a personal item. International Basic Economy usually includes a full carry-on.
